India wicketkeeper-batter Kona Srikar Bharat has announced his retirement from international cricket after playing seven Tests for the country. The 32-year-old debuted in 2023 and played his last Test a year later, scoring 221 runs. He also holds the record for the first triple century by a wicketkeeper-batter in Ranji Trophy.

Indian-origin golfer Manav Shah, born in California to Gujarati parents, is set to make his US Open debut after years of dedication on public courses and global qualifying circuits. His journey includes reconnecting with his Indian roots through the Asian Tour and the Indian Golf Premier League, which he credits for strengthening his self-belief.
